Key Technical Features

This model uses the 127 mm HCK mounting format with M12 fixing. It is intended for reservoir wall installation where the operator needs a direct view of the fluid column. The GL-P execution supports use in suitable oil, water, or glycol-based fluid environments, while FKM seals contribute to dependable performance under compatible operating conditions.

The “80-NC” part of the code is important. It identifies an 80°C temperature monitoring configuration with normally closed contact logic. In industrial systems, this can support early detection of overheating conditions, especially where hydraulic oil temperature directly affects viscosity, lubrication quality, and component life.

Why Temperature Monitoring Matters

Hydraulic systems rely on fluid condition. Excessive temperature can accelerate oil degradation, reduce lubrication quality, damage seals, and affect pump efficiency. A level indicator with an 80°C normally closed temperature function can help machine builders and maintenance teams introduce a clear warning point into the system.

What does 80-NC mean?

It refers to an 80°C temperature threshold with normally closed contact logic, depending on the system wiring and control configuration.
